The Karate Kid Part II

After learning that his father is dying, karate master Mr. Miyagi (Noriyuki "Pat" Morita) returns home to Okinawa, bringing his protege, Daniel (Ralph Macchio), with him. In Japan, Miyagi is surprised to discover that his old sweetheart, Yukie (Nobu McCarthy), has remained single. Meanwhile, Daniel is attracted to Yukie's niece, Kumiko (Tamlyn Tomita). But romance must be put on hold while Daniel and Miyagi deal with local bullies and long-harbored grudges.

The Art of War

He is both agent and weapon - a critical line of defense for the Secretary General of the United Nations. He does not even officially exist. Neil Shaw, an American agent who must uncover an international plot to bring down the United Nations on the eve of an historic summit with China. A mysterious chain of events leads to the murder of the Chinese U.N. Ambassador. When Shaw is accused of the crime, he must go underground -- in effect, vanish from his own life.

3 Ninjas: High Noon at Mega Mountain

Ninja brothers Colt (Michael J. O'Laskey II), Rocky (Mathew Botuchis) and Tum Tum (Victor Wong) go to an amusement park to get a glimpse of their idol, action star Dave Dragon (Hulk Hogan). But when evil masterminds Medusa (Loni Anderson) and Lothar Zogg (Jim Varney) descend on the park, the boys are thrust into a real-life shoot-'em-up. Now they must use their martial-arts training to defend the park's helpless guests -- getting a little assistance from their longtime hero.
